8. Wooden Storage Bench

How can you combine extra seating with a clever way to hide away your outdoor accessories? A wooden storage bench is a multi-functional hero for any balcony, providing a sturdy place to sit while concealing cushions or gardening tools. Opt for high-quality teak or cedar wood, which naturally resists decay and develops a beautiful patina over time. You can top the bench with a long custom cushion and several plush pillows to make it a comfortable reading nook. This design works exceptionally well against a back wall, leaving the rest of the balcony floor clear for movement. It effectively solves the common problem of clutter in limited outdoor areas.

18. Teak Dining Set

Do you appreciate the warmth and durability of natural materials for your outdoor dining experiences? A teak dining set is a premium choice that brings a touch of luxury and organic beauty to any balcony. Teak is highly valued for its natural oils, which make it exceptionally resistant to water, rot, and pests without needing much care. A small square or round teak table with four matching chairs creates a sophisticated setting for family meals under the stars. Over time, the wood will age to a graceful silver-gray, or you can apply oil to maintain its original golden-brown hue. It is an investment in both style and long-lasting quality.
